In a world where technology continually evolves, the UEFI Shell emerges as a pivotal tool for advanced users and developers seeking to transcend traditional DOS limitations. M Rothman delves into the intricacies of this modern interface, shedding light on its capabilities and offering a comprehensive guide designed to empower its users. This exploration reveals how the UEFI Shell provides a robust environment for platform management, firmware access, and system diagnostics, far surpassing outdated command-line interfaces.
Through detailed explanations and practical examples, readers are introduced to the fundamental features of the UEFI Shell, enabling them to navigate its functionality with confidence. The author emphasizes not just the how-to, but also the underlying principles that make the UEFI Shell a preferred choice for modern computing tasks. This approach allows both novices and experienced users to grasp essential concepts while enhancing their technical proficiency.
As readers progress, they encounter various applications of the UEFI Shell, demonstrating its versatility across different platforms and systems. M Rothman articulates the potential of this powerful tool, encouraging users to harness its capabilities for efficient system management, troubleshooting, and development. By framing the UEFI Shell as more than just a replacement for DOS, the narrative inspires a deeper appreciation for its role in contemporary technology.
In a time where understanding firmware and system architecture is crucial for IT professionals, this guide serves as an essential resource for anyone looking to elevate their skills in computer management. Rothman's insights pave the way for a new era of platform engagement, positioning the UEFI Shell as a key player in the future of user interaction with technology.
